In a significant and potentially historic diplomatic shift, France is reportedly preparing to formally recognize the State of Palestine in September. This announcement comes amid heightened international focus on the Israeli-Palestinian conflict and increasing pressure on global powers to take meaningful steps toward a two-state solution.
France has long supported the idea of a Palestinian state as part of a negotiated settlement, but this would mark the first time it takes official action to recognize Palestine independently. French officials have hinted that this move is part of a broader effort to reignite peace talks and send a clear message that the status quo—marked by violence, occupation, and political deadlock—is no longer acceptable.
If France proceeds with this recognition, it would become one of the most prominent Western nations to do so, following similar actions by Ireland, Spain, Norway, and Sweden. Such recognition may not immediately change realities on the ground, but it carries heavy symbolic and diplomatic weight. It can influence EU policy, bolster Palestine’s standing in international institutions, and potentially shift the tone of global diplomacy.
However, the decision is not without its critics. Advocates view it as a long-overdue recognition of Palestinian rights and a crucial step toward fairness and accountability. Detractors, meanwhile, express concern that such a move could further complicate the already fragile peace process or strain diplomatic ties with Israel—without delivering tangible improvements for Palestinians on the ground.
This raises several important questions for the global community:
1. Will France's decision encourage other nations, especially in the West, to follow suit?
2. Could this shift bring fresh momentum to a stalled peace process?
3. How will Israel and the United States respond to this recognition?
4. And perhaps most importantly, what impact will this have on the lives of ordinary Palestinians?
September could mark a turning point—or it could end up being another symbolic gesture in a long history of unresolved conflict.
